France’s Sarkozy stripped of Legion of Honour, nation’s top award

Al JazeeraSunday, June 15, 2025 at 11:54:53 AM
France’s former president Nicolas Sarkozy has lost the Legion of Honour, the country’s highest civilian award, after being found guilty of corruption and influence peddling. The decision underscores the legal fallout from his 2021 conviction and marks a dramatic fall from grace for the once-powerful leader.
